I want to add a grapple for this Massey Ferguson 1526, but finding a good recommendation for this specific model has been a bit of a challenge, most of what I see out there is geared toward larger tractors, and I don't want to end up with something that's overkill and eats up all my lift capacity, I'll be using it just for brush cleanup, fallen limbs, and moving logs around the property enough that forks just aren't cutting it anymore. I've got a third function kit lined up though, just need to get the right grapple.

Recos please
 
Look into the EA 55" Wicked Root Grapple. What I like about it is that it's lightweight but still bites hard for cleanup like you're planning. But make sure your third function lines are spaced right for the couplers they use. It's hard messing that up.
 
Frontier and Rhino offer models that balance strength without maxing out your lift capacity. You have the third function so you can get a hydraulic grapple which really makes handling brush easier.
